R1. Westspeed Stayers\' Bonus Handicap - Scott Embry

I have a feeling this will be a casual Sunday stroll with nobody overly keen to lead. I see Lucy rolling forwards with Black Uma who returns to the track after over a year on the sidelines and I think she can lead and control the tempo. First-up over 2000m he is definitely not a betting proposition but this race lacks depth and quality so I'm happy enough to tip him on top as the value. Mystic Prince is obviously the one to beat. He has been given every single favour his last two and should get them again here. Anything over about $2.50 would tempt most. Battle Ace made ground on a heavily leader bias track last week and I think he can play a part in the finish.

3. BLACK UMA - 2. MYSTIC PRINCE - 5. BATTLE ACE

    R2. Tabtouch Supporting Wa Racing Handicap - Scott Embry

    Zarantz is a regular on this preview, I still have a big opinion of him and even though he drops back to a mile here I think he can prove too strong. The tempo should be genuine with iron mare Fathnoxious likely to roll along out in front. Zarantz hopefully will settle a bit closer to the pace and grind over them with the fitness edge in his legs. Top Show will most likely have to come from last and will be finishing down the middle alongside little mare Need a Lift. They will both appreciate a genuine tempo. Fathnoxious was undone by 2000m last start and looks much better suited over a mile.

    6. ZARANTZ - 5. TOP SHOW - 3. FATHNOXIOUS

    R3. Belmont Newmarket - Scott Embry

    Cool Trade looks a weight special with a massive 3kg drop for being beaten a nose by Rebel King. On the other end of the spectrum he must carry an extra 2.5kg. The massive weight swing in favour of Cool Trade makes her one, if not the, best bet of the day. A small field should suit and it would be no surprise to see her cross and lead. Never missed the money second-up and a 4 time winner at 1200m this Listed Feature looks hers for the taking. Wink and a Nod was heavily supported last start before settling a bit too far back with Lucy trying to pinch runs to save ground. Meets Cool Trade 2kg worse at the weights for her defeat but should appreciate a small field. Rock Magic is always a chance but lumps a big weight relative to the mares. Happy to label Smoko as the lay of the day.

    5. COOL TRADE - 6. WINK AND A NOD - 1. ROCK MAGIC

    R4. Craig Perkins 40th Birthday Handicap - Scott Embry

    Zuccheros' last start win over 1200m was nothing short of emphatic. 1300m looks right up his alley and the race should be run to suit. Carrying only 55kg from a gun barrier he should be a safe investment in the closing leg of the early quadrella. Should settle midfield and be saved for one last burst of speed. McScar is one I'm happy to throw up at odds, currently about 50-1 which I think is probably overs. Last week he would have slept for atleast 3 days after the deadset shocker Kate Fitzgerald gave him. Slowly away he was urged forwards to sit outside War Prince as they set a new sectional record out in front. He faded badly in the straight but all things considered it wasn't the worst effort at all. Danablue can figure in the finish, run off his feet first-up in the HG Bolton behind Rebel King, this is miles easier.

    4. ZUCCHEROS - 10. MCSCAR - 2. DANABLUE

    R6. Westspeed 3yo Plate - Scott Embry

    I have a very high opinion of Hot Goods and I think he can over come all the hurdles and win this race. His debut effort down the Pinjarra straight was enormous yet effortless. Immediately tipped out for a spell his warm-up trial was blistering and I think he will be very, very hard to beat here. Drawn barrier 11 of 11 with a deal of speed drawn inside including Krypto Kid who will be settling the grass alight with Kate Fitzgerald likely to put the foot down and fly early and Castle Queen who is no slouch out of the gates. On paper the race maps to perfection for London Line, winner of the Supremacy Stakes as a 2 year old before a gutsy fourth to Lucky Street in the Perth Stakes but I'm putting Hot Goods on top because I do think he is an exciting proposition. Those two should kick away by 3 or 4 lengths and run a short but sweet quinella.

    7. HOT GOODS - 1. LONDON LINE - 2. KRYPTO KID
